My partner is a complete music boffin, and has a G4 iBook running panther. But everytime he see's my iMac's iTunes album art screensaver he wants it more and more!
Anyone know of a similar screensaver or anyone know how to get the screensaver from Tiger to shove onto his iBook???
Cheers!
fistful
Apr 4, 2006, 05:16 PM
You could possibly copy it from your system on to his but there is no guarantee it will work, if fact I'd be surprised if it did.
It's located under: system < library < screen savers < "iTunes Artwork.saver"
eva01
Apr 4, 2006, 05:23 PM
It may use Core Image in which case it wouldn't work
